1 Section: FN (Finance) Effective Date: July 1, 2011 Policy Type: Company Wide Revision Date(s): POLICY:. The Rural/Metro Corporation Surety Bond Policy and Procedure has been developed by the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to document the types of bonding arrangements and the internal procedures required to issue and renew bonds. RESPONSIBLE OFFICER: Senior Vice President and Chief Financial Officer PROCEDURE: I. DEFINITIONS A surety bond is a three-party agreement (contract) between the contractor ( Principal Rural/Metro ), the project owner ( Obligee ) and the surety company ( Surety ); whereby the Surety agrees to make the Obligee whole if the Principal defaults in the performance of its promise to the Obligee. A. Generally four types of surety bonds: 1. Performance/Indemnity Bond Protects the Obligee from non-performance and financial exposure should the Principal default under the contract. It is directly tied to the underlying contract in accordance with the terms and conditions. 2. Bid Bond An obligation undertaken by the bidder promising that the bidder will, if awarded the contract within the time stipulated, enter into the contract and furnish the prescribed performance bonds. 3. Payment Bond (labor and materials bond) Assures Principal will pay certain workers, subcontractors and material suppliers. Rural/Metro does not typically issue this type of bond 4. Fiduciary Bond Used to secure the proper performance of fiduciary duties by persons in positions of private or public trust, i.e., ERISA type plans, Notary Bonds, Page 1 of 9
2 B. Other definitions: etc. Rural/Metro deems this type of coverage to be more closely aligned with an insurance policy for the Company and therefore management falls under the Risk Management Group. 1. Penal Sum A specified amount of money which is the maximum amount the Surety would be required to pay in the event of the Principal s default. This allows the Surety to assess the risk involved in giving the bond. 2. Broker Rural/Metro utilized a third-party broker to assist in working with various Surety s to obtain bond lines of credit, issue bonds and assist on the renewal process. 3. Premium Annual cost to issue a bond, generally 2% - 3% of Penal Sum. 4. Continuous Bonds Will automatically renew each year with no further action required by the Principal. A formal notification to Surety is required to cancel or not renew. II. PREQUALIFICATIONS A. Before issuing a bond, the Surety assesses the Principal s entire business operation to get fully satisfied, among other criteria, that the Principal has: 1. Adequate financial resources to meet current and future obligations. 2. Necessary industry experience and equipment to meet contract requirements. 3. Appropriate management skills and organizational support to carry on the business and successfully perform under the contract. 4. Financial strength and excellent credit history. 5. Established banking relationships and lines of credit. Page 2 of 9
3 B. Through this review process the Surety will verify the Principal is capable of performing the job being contracted for and is therefore willing to underwrite the bond with little exception of loss. III. CLAIMS UNDER A BOND A. When a claim is filed by an Obligee against a bond, the Surety has an obligation to both the Obligee and the Principal. If the Principal and the Obligee disagree on contract performance issues and the Obligee declares the Principal in default, the Surety must investigate the claim. B. Limitations of Bonds: 1. A bond is not an insurance policy, does not cover personal injury or property damage that may result from Prinicpal s negligence. 2. A bond does not provide financial protection to the Principal in the event there is a dispute with the Obligee. 3. Covers only completion or correction costs within the scope of the original contract. IV. PROCEDURES TO REQUEST A NEW BOND A. Operations: 1. Performance/Indemnity Bonds: a. Note: there are a couple of specific bond limitations to watch out for when reviewing a Request for Proposal ( RFP ): i. Any forfeiture type bond language in an RFP must be deleted. This type of bond language is no longer available in the surety markets. ii. All bonds issued are limited to one year in duration. If you are entering into a contract with a five (5) year term, the contract must state that all parties agree to accept a one year bond with annual extensions thereafter. In addition, it is requested that you make every attempt to orchestrate including the Rural/Metro Corporation bond format (See Exhibit A - RURAL/METRO CORPORATION BOND FORMAT) as an exhibit when responding the RFP. This will eliminate lengthy bond format negotiations after a contract is awarded. 2. Bid Bonds: a.
